Identification and Optimization Strategy of Ecological Security Pattern in Zhaoyuan City

Abstract: Abstract Human activities have seriously threatened the natural ecological security at present. In order to better promote the construction of ecological civilization, how to accurately identify the ecological security pattern has become the key. Taking Zhaoyuan City, a typical resource-rich coastal city, as the research object, the ecological source was identified comprehensively based on habitat quality and ecosystem service value combined with landscape connectivity. The MCR model was used to construct the comprehensive resistance surface, and the circuit theory was used to extract the ecological corridor and ecological key points. Based on this, the ecological security pattern of the coastal resource-rich area was constructed, and the targeted restoration suggestions were put forward.
